Mystery digger ruins 5,000-year-old dolmen


La Hougue de Vinde dolmen near Noirmont has been seriously damaged after someone dug holes all over the 5,000 year old historical site.

A man was seen illegally using a metal detector and a trowel on the ancient site, prompting the island’s heritage organisations to appeal to the public to help protect them... continues...

La Hougue de Vinde is a cist-in-circle, a type of monument peculiar to the Channel Islands.

We liked this place - and it seemed to like us. It's been robbed - the cist has long since gone; damaged, overgrown and neglected; not easy to find in the trees. Branches overhang and encroach into the inner space. A saw is needed here. There's a geocache. Yet, despite all the setbacks, we were pleased to be there in its stillness to share its existence.
